Cost-effectiveness

Bean-to-cup machines are a great option for both consumers and businesses. They are simple to use and can make high-quality coffee with the click of the button. They are also less expensive to maintain and can help reduce the amount of waste. They are a great choice for bars, restaurants, and cafes. In addition, they reduce costs by removing the necessity for expensive pods. Based on the machine, some even offer hot chocolate and other instant drinks.

The most expensive cost associated with a bean to cup cofee machine is the cost of the beans and milk. The bulk purchase of these items can cut down on expenses significantly. The upfront investment can be a hurdle for many businesses. Many companies choose to finance or lease their equipment.

Bean-to-cup machines grind fresh beans unlike traditional coffee makers. This gives the coffee a deeper flavor than beans that have been pre-ground. The oil in the beans loses its flavour with time and grinding them only as necessary ensures the best taste possible.

Maintenance

Previously restricted to the barista bars of professional coffee shops, bean-to-cup machines are now exploding in popularity. These modern machines grind whole beans, press and brew all in one go, making an array of drinks including espresso, cappuccino flat white, flat white and many more. However, a machine that is bean-to-cup may be damaged and cease to function due to inadequate maintenance. It is essential to clean and descale the machine regularly in order to prevent this. These steps should be done on a regular basis and can be done without the need for expensive equipment or a professional service.

First start by running a cleaning program on the coffee maker. This will ensure that any residue of the coffee machine is removed. This will also prevent clogs, and reduce the amount of water required. Most bean-to-cup machines will include a cleaning process that can be activated by pressing a button or by using the menu that appears on screen. You will usually be prompted to place a cup under the spout so that the cleaning water doesn't take the drip tray.

Some machines feature an milk system that produces frothy espresso. It is crucial to keep the system clean, as bacterial contamination can grow and cause unpleasant tasting drinks. Additionally, the milk piping can be obstructed by dried residue, which is harmful to the machine and to your health.

Cleaning the machine will also include rinsing the dreg drawer and drip tray on a regular basis. The drawer and dreg tray should be cleaned at the end each day. This will depend on the amount of drinks you make each day. Check the manual for more details.

The best way to stop the accumulation of limescale is by using an descaling program every week. This will eliminate the hardened deposits, stopping them from blocking the machine and causing it to taste bitter. Regular descaling safeguards the inside of the coffee machine and extends its life.
